In the UK, the rise of electric vehicles (EVs) has led to an increasing demand for professionals in the EV charging system finance sector.
The career advancement opportunities are abundant, with various roles available that cater to different skill sets and backgrounds.
Here are some of the key positions in this field and their respective responsibilities: 1. EV Charging System Technician: These professionals install, maintain, and repair EV charging stations.
They need to have a solid understanding of electrical systems and be able to troubleshoot issues efficiently. (30% of the job market) 2. Finance Analyst for EV Charging Systems: Finance analysts in this sector focus on financial modeling, forecasting, and budgeting for EV charging infrastructure projects.
They need a strong background in finance and data analysis. (25% of the job market) 3. Project Manager for EV Charging Infrastructure: Project managers oversee the development, implementation, and monitoring of EV charging projects.
They require excellent organizational skills, strategic thinking, and experience in project management. (20% of the job market) 4. Sales Manager for EV Charging Solutions: Sales managers in this domain are responsible for driving sales and developing business strategies for EV charging solutions.
They need strong interpersonal skills, a deep understanding of the market, and the ability to build relationships with clients. (15% of the job market) 5. Data Scientist for EV Charging Optimization: Data scientists analyze data from EV charging stations and use it to optimize charging infrastructure, improve energy efficiency, and enhance user experience.
They require a background in data science and a strong understanding of machine learning algorithms. (10% of the job market) These roles offer competitive salary ranges, with finance analysts and project managers typically earning higher salaries due to their specialized skill sets.
As the EV industry continues to grow, so will the demand for professionals in these key positions.
